Abstract
In this paper a method for very low bit rate coding of video sequences is described. The method is based on spatio-temporal segmentation of the sequence into semantically significant regions with polygonal shapes. The motion parameters, structural description of regions and reconstruction by motion compensation error should be encoded to reconstruct high quality images at the decoder. In the coding scheme, the temporal coherence of the regions structure and of motion compensation error are taken into account in the encoding scheme to achieve a very low bit rate.
